New and used buyers are different.
When someone wants new, they want new.
There are times I wanted new and other times I wanted used.
Never did I seek to buy a new car and settle in a used one.
That's why I think the "just buy a used Tesla" arguement is slightly flawed.
If they make a low cost Tesla they will sell them like hot cakes.
